Hello folks,
quick question, my 08 AT has a slight jerk in it when coasting to stop sign from 60 MPH, not stepping on the gas at all.
Feels like the tranny downshifts as the speed decreases, is that supposed to happen? Watching the tach it bounces from like 800RPM to 1100 RPM as the tranny is downshifting through the gears.
It has almost 73K on it.

IMHO...
The trannies have to down shift at some point in order to be ready to give you the right gear in case you suddenly need power.
I use engine braking a lot in the Colorado mountains but have to manually (at highway speeds) down shift to get enough gear reduction to do the job on long 7% grades.
It's possible it is shifting two gears at one time. How long since the at fluid was changed? Check the color and smell.
